Dozens of teams competed the final night of National Poetry Slam qualifying bouts on Thursday for a shot to move on to the semifinal round. With several teams already all but assured of a spot after their performances earlier in the week, the competition was fierce for a shot at making it into one of the 20 open spots.
By the end of the night, all the scores were tabulated and the teams moving on to the semifinals were decided. They are: Atlanta JM, Austin AP, Austin SF, Baltimore, Berkeley, Boston CT, Charlotte SC, Chicago MG, Denver DM, Denver NU, Lincoln, Los Angeles, New York LA, New York NU, Oakland, Richmond, St. Paul, San Diego, San Francisco, and Silver City.
The four semifinal bout match-ups at the Overture Center have been determined along with the specific venues. The are:
- Oakland, Charlotte SC, St. Paul, Baltimore, and Chicago MG in Promenade Hall
- Denver NU, Atlanta JM, Los Angeles, Austin AP, Richmond SR in Wisconsin Hall
- San Diego, Denver DM, San Francisco, Lincoln, and Boston CT in the Rotunda
- New York LA, Austin SF, New York NU, Berkeley, and Silver City in the Playhouse
